IPC-A-610 Certification

Course Description:

The education and training goal of this program is to improve the accuracy of distinguishing between “acceptable” and “unacceptable” electronic printed circuit board assemblies according to the IPC-A-610 Rev. H. standard.

Course Topics:

  • Introduction / IPC Professional Policies and Procedures (Module 2, required)
  • Foreword, Applicable Documents, & Handling (Module 3, optional)
  • Hardware Installation (Module 4, optional)
  • Soldering (Including High Voltage) (Module 5, optional)
  • Terminal Connections (Requires Modules 4 & 8 prior) (Module 6, optional)
  • Through-Hole Technology (Including TH Jumper Wires) (Requires Modules 4 & 8 prior) (Module 7, optional)
  • Surface Mount Assemblies (Including SMT Jumper Wires) (Requires Modules 4 & 8 prior) (Module 8, optional)
  • Component Damage and Printed Circuit Boards and Assemblies (Module 9, optional)
  • Solderless Wire Wrap
